Change from import data source to Power BI dataset

I have a report where I've imported data from some tables, created visuals and published it to the Power BI service. Any new reports I create can use this Power BI dataset and connect live to it, but I would also like to change my existing report to use the Power BI dataset instead of the imported dataset. Then I could have a separate pbix file for working with the import dataset and have all report files use the Power BI dataset. Is there any way to do this or do I have to re-create the report using the Power BI dataset? I don't know if it's relevant for this, but we have a Premium capacity.

So I believe in that situation you will need to create a new PBIX file that connects live. Then you should be able to copy and paste your visuals over and have it work.
